WinDES (Windows Design System) is a software package developed by Micro Drainage (now part of Innovyze, which is now part of Autodesk) for designing and analyzing urban drainage systems. It's used by civil engineers and drainage professionals to model surface water runoff, design sustainable drainage systems (SuDS), and ensure compliance with regulatory requirements. WinDES helps in the design of various drainage components, including pipes, manholes, and storage facilities, and facilitates the analysis of their performance under different rainfall scenarios.
